The word "birdnest" can be understood as both a noun and a verb, and it relates to the homes of birds. Let’s break it down:

As a Noun:
  • Definition: A birdnest is a structure made by birds where they lay their eggs and raise their young. It can be found in trees, bushes, or even on buildings.
  • Example: "The robin built a birdnest in the tree outside my window."
As a Verb:
  • Definition: To birdnest means to gather or collect birdnests, usually in a way that might be considered exploring or searching for them.
  • Example: "They went birdnesting in the early morning to see if they could find any nests."

Word Variants:
  • The word itself doesn't have many direct variants, but you might see related terms:
    • Birdnester: Someone who collects birdnests.
    • Birdnesting: The act of searching for or collecting birdnests.
Different Meanings:
  • In some contexts, "bird's nest" may refer to a delicacy in some cultures (like bird's nest soup made from the nests of certain birds), but this is a more specific use of the term.
